Mikulski Continues To Chair NASA Oversight Subcommittee Sen. Barbara A. Mikulski (D-Md.) will continue to chair the Senate Appropriations Committee commerce, justice, science and related agencies subcommittee for the next two years, full committee chairman Daniel K. Inouye (D-Hawaii) announced. Other Democrats serving on the panel include Inouye and Sens. Patrick Leahy, Herb Kohl, Byron Dorgan, Dianne Feinstein, Jack Reed, Frank Lautenberg, Ben Nelson and Mark Pryor.
